Security
« on: April 02, 2013, 09:50:12 am »

I'm currently using Gizmo to remote control MC18 from *inside* my home network.  I see that, with Port Forwarding, I should be able to access MC from *outside* as well.  From what I've read, the typical setup is to configure my router to forward requests from the internet, on port 52199, to the MC18 server on my home network.

Can anyone speak to whatever security controls, if any, exist in MC18 to limit access to the music server.  Or, can anyone who sees my outside IP address and finds port 52199 open come in and play?

Re: Security
« Reply #1 on: April 02, 2013, 10:24:53 am »

You should enable authentication in Options > Media Network if you open the port.

With that enabled, it's perfectly safe.  There are no known security vulnerabilities, and if one should ever be found, it will be fixed immediately.
